Trina Solar Brings Advanced Solar Innovations to Vietnam, Demonstrates Commitment to Empowering Renewable Sector


HO CHI MINH CITY, Vietnam, May 8,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Trina Solar, a global leader in smart PV and energy storage solutions, has been steadily ramping up production at its manufacturing facility in northern Vietnam, demonstrating its commitment to the local market.

When the US$203 million factory in the northern city of Thai Nguyen started production last August it had 700 workers and was producing its industry-leading 210mm monocrystalline silicon wafers. Since then, the workforce has more than doubled to 1,500 workers and the factory is now also producing solar cells and modules; representing more advanced stages of value-added manufacturing.

The facility is now steadily ramping up to its maximum annual production capacity: 6.5GW of wafers, 4GW solar cells and 5GW modules.

Some of Vietnam's largest utility-scale as well as commercial and industrial (C&I) solar projects are powered by Trina Solar modules. Utility-scale projects powered by Trina Solar Vertex modules include the 51MW Dam Tra O floating solar farm, in the central coastal province of Binh Dinh, and the 49MW Vinh Long ground-mounted solar farm near the southern tip of Vietnam.

"Trina Solar modules use dual-glass, useful for challenging environments like these where proximity to the sea means higher humidity and salt spray," says Wang.

"Solar energy is the right choice for Vietnam because it's proven technology that can be quickly and readily deployed, even in challenging sites," she adds.



Vietnam's transition to renewable energy comes as the country's electricity needs continue to increase due to strong economic growth projected at 5-7% per annum over the coming years. 

Under Vietnam's Power Development Plan VIII, the country is looking to phase out coal-fired power generation by 2050 and increase solar power installed capacity to account for 34%, up from 23% in 2022. The Power Development Plan also forecasts that energy storage will increase to 300 MWh by 2030 and 26 GWh by 2050.

In fact, 26,554 Vertex double-glass bifacial modules have been installed on the company's own Vietnam cell and module factory in the Thai Nguyen province. The 12.6MW project was connected to the grid on 6 December last year, and is expected to generate an average annual power output of approximately 11.29 million kilowatt hours, satisfying the entire factory's annual electricity demands.

Combining bifacial modules with TrinaTracker Vanguard 1P and 2P trackers, meanwhile, provides additional power. These dynamic trackers follow the movement of the sun and can harvest much more sunlight throughout the day. On a typical sunny day for an installation on sandy ground surface, bifacial modules on trackers significantly outperform the energy output of a standard fixed-tilt ground mounted system. The company's new-generation trackers have a motorised system, reducing the number of mechanical parts, which means the trackers are quicker to install and have lower maintenance costs over the product's lifecycle.

The Vanguard 1P and 2P trackers also provide additional energy yield because these are 'smart trackers' that uses sensors to capture data as well as sophisticated algorithms to determine the best angles to tilt the modules to maximize light capture and thus power generation. 

In energy storage, Trina Storage recently launched the 4.07MWh Elementa 2 battery energy storage system (BESS) that can fit inside a standard 20ft-long shipping container for easy transportation. The new generation liquid-cooled energy storage system has lithium iron phosphate cells developed in-house and is an advanced energy storage solution for various applications.
